Sumario:This study’s aim is to calculate and analyze the Symmetric Revealed Comparative Advantage Index of the main agricultural products exported by Brazil. This is a longitudinal quantitative study based on data collected electronically from the home page of the Food and Agriculture Organization and from the Ministry of Industry, Development and Foreign Trade for the period from 2003 to 2014. The calculated results point to a fairly high comparative advantage of products such as soy, sugar, orange juice, and chicken, while maize and cotton show moderate indices. On the other extreme, values for raw materials and processed foods show no comparative advantage, being even negative ones.
